GroundForce Capital backs Epicutis skincare brand
The company's science-backed formulations, built on proprietary patent-protected actives, are carried in over 4,100 medspas, dermatology practices, and luxury spas nationwide.
Takeaways
- Epicutis is a Professional skincare company developing science-backed products for dermatology and aesthetics practices.
- GroundForce Capital is acquiring Epicutis.
GroundForce Capital has made a growth investment in Epicutis, a science-backed skincare brand that develops clean, minimalist formulations from proprietary biotechnology-derived actives.
Born from over 20 years of bioscience research affiliated with Princeton University through Signum Biosciences, the company has scaled revenue at nearly a 100% compound annual growth rate over the past two years.
The investment will support expansion as the professional channel sees momentum from consumers seeking practitioner-recommended products.
“Epicutis has built something rare in skincare: a genuinely differentiated scientific platform paired with the sales execution to bring it to market at scale,” said Dan Gluck, Co-Founder and Co-Managing Partner of GroundForce Capital.
GroundForce Capital is a founder-led consumer products investor with portfolio brands including Bobbie, Liquid Death, and OWYN.
DC Advisory served as exclusive financial advisor to Epicutis.
